India will soon open
its sixth legation in Seattle to cater to the needs of great number of
Indian-Americans living in the northwestern part of the U.S.
“We hope to open a new Indian legation in Seattle,” Indian
Foreign Typist S. Jaishankar said afterward the assumption of the talks between
Prime Minister Narendra Modi and U.S. President Barack Obama at the White
House.
